128066283 has 24 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 189034560. Its totient is φ = 83529600.
The previous prime is 128066269. The next prime is 128066299. The reversal of 128066283 is 382660821.
128066283 is a `hidden beast` number, since 1 + 28 + 0 + 6 + 628 + 3 = 666.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 128066283 - 28 = 128066027 is a prime.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(128066243)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 23 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 80110 + ... + 81692.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(7876440).
Almost surely, 2128066283 is an apocalyptic number.
128066283 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(60968277).
128066283 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
128066283 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 1779 (or 1776 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 27648, while the sum is 36.
The square root of 128066283 is about 11316.6374422794. The cubic root of 128066283 is about 504.0553959330.
The spelling of 128066283 in words is "one hundred twenty-eight million, sixty-six thousand, two hundred eighty-three".
